Plumber Prices in Bletchley

Service Typical Cost Unit
Callout charge (first hour) £50 – £75 per callout
Hourly labour rate (standard hours) £45 – £65 per hour
Emergency/out-of-hours labour £65 – £95 per hour
Tap repair or replacement £120 – £250 per job
Radiator installation (single) £200 – £400 per job
Boiler service and safety check £120 – £180 per job
Toilet repair or replacement £150 – £350 per job
Full bathroom installation (suite) £2500 – £6000 per job

Prices are indicative averages for Bletchley. Actual quotes will vary based on job specifics.

What Affects the Cost?

Plumber pricing in Bletchley is influenced by several key factors. Job complexity—from straightforward tap replacements to involved pipework modifications—directly affects labour time and cost. Material quality and type (standard plastic fittings vs. premium brass or copper) varies pricing significantly. Local factors include access difficulty, whether work requires lifting floorboards, and proximity to water mains. Emergency or weekend call-outs attract premiums of 30-50%. The age and condition of your plumbing system may reveal hidden issues, affecting final costs.

Money-Saving Tips

Get quotes from at least three local plumbers before committing. Book preventative maintenance in winter months when demand is lower. Request itemised quotes separating labour and materials. Consider batching multiple small jobs into one visit to reduce callout charges. Regular boiler servicing prevents costly emergency repairs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the typical callout charge for a plumber in Bletchley?
Most plumbers in Bletchley charge £50-75 for a callout, which typically covers the first hour of labour. This fee is often deducted from the final bill if work proceeds. Emergency or out-of-hours callouts cost significantly more, usually £70-95+.
How long do emergency plumbing repairs typically take?
Simple fixes like bleeding radiators or reseating a leaky tap take 30-60 minutes. More complex issues (burst pipes, boiler faults) require 2-4 hours or may need return visits. Always ask for an estimate before authorising work.
Are plumbing rates higher in Bletchley than the national average?
Yes—Bletchley rates are typically 15-25% above national average due to South East positioning and proximity to London. However, you're paying for experienced local tradespeople with faster response times and familiarity with local water board requirements.
What's included in a boiler service and should I get one annually?
A service includes safety checks, cleaning, efficiency testing, and fault diagnosis, costing £120-180 in Bletchley. Annual services are recommended by boiler manufacturers and your insurer—they prevent breakdowns, maintain efficiency, and protect your warranty.
